Workflow 2.0 - Improving release monitoring with commit metadata #36492
NisanthanNanthakumar
announced in
Product Spitballin'
Replies: 0 comments
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
-
A key objective of Workflow 2.0 is improving the quality of release notifications, which relies heavily on accurately associating releases with code commits and the users associated with these commits. With this information, we can provide timely and actionable notifications to users who are most invested in a release.
We aim to give users the ability to share commit metadata in one of two ways:
We just deployed a quickstart for releases here, that you'll see if you have not yet set up a release for the selected project. Here, you'll be able to copy and paste the code snippet directly into your CI config file.
We will be iterating upon this page to reduce friction.
We are also enhancing our GitHub integration to make it easier to use and will be rolling out improvements over the coming weeks.
Developers will have the flexibility to choose the approach that works best for them. We’re about developers first!
Do share your thoughts on these approaches and how else we could make gathering commit metadata more effective.
Beta Was this translation helpful? Give feedback.
All reactions